We've all heard the adage: money can't buy happiness. In this TEDx talk, social psychologist Michael Norton shares fascinating research on how money can, indeed buy happiness - when you don't spend it on yourself. The studies show that the specific way (or the amount) you spend on others isn't nearly as important as the fact that you spend on other people. Listen to the surprising data on how pro-social spending can benefit you, your work, and (of course) other people.
